BLACKENED REDFISH | |
2 redfish fillets 2 sticks butter, melted 3 tsp. cayenne pepper 1 tsp. thyme 2 tsp. granulated garlic 1 tsp. salt 1 tsp. lemon pepper Combine butter and spices in shallow pan. Add fillets and let sit in marinade until it coats well. Place iron skillet on stove until hot - it should be so hot it will turn a grayish white. Carefully place fillets in skillet and cook, depending on thickness, approximately 1 to 1 1/2 minutes per side. Squeeze lemon juice on fillets and serve. Hints: Cut off ends of fillets for they will cook faster than the thicker parts and will stick to the pan. Also, when getting ready to cook make sure vents and windows are open; it will get smokey. |
